Transaction 05bc649f36e58a61c6104eedeb57a74fdce70ac72dea2992f59dcb1a70fe491e

1 Input
2 Outputs
  • 05bc649f36e58a61c6104eedeb57a74fdce70ac72dea2992f59dcb1a70fe491e:0
  • value  1367547
    address  1J6kFMieEj9SvCbuCSiuqNoMMYDCzhPevZ
  • 05bc649f36e58a61c6104eedeb57a74fdce70ac72dea2992f59dcb1a70fe491e:1
  • value  26311294
    address  3JZijqkmM71vsKAZSzvr6SRQ3FxTzhFHKT